## Service Accounts: Calendar Sync Conflict

The svc-calmerge account double-books rooms when Planwheel and Tidegrid both write to the shared calendar. Until the dedupe patch lands, only svc-calmerge should hold write scope; revoke Tidegrid's token after each sync window. The account authenticates against the Roomline API using the key below.

service key, fawip-bajef: kto11_Qt5wZK9vdNC

**Q: How is the Pellwick profile store sharded?**

By user ID hash, 64 shards, consistent hashing ring managed by the Ferrule router. Resharding is online but slow — budget a week per doubling. Don't write directly to shards; always go through Ferrule or you'll break rebalance bookkeeping. Hot-shard alerts fire at 3x median load. Shard map, migration status, and escalation steps live on the page below.

wiki page, tahaf-tajog: https://jira.ordindyn.corp/pipeline

## Sensor drift: what to do at 3am

If the GrowLoop controller starts reporting humidity swings that don't match the backup probes in the Fernwick greenhouse, it's almost always sensor drift, not an actual climate event. Don't panic and don't touch the vents manually. First, restart the calibration daemon and give it ten minutes to re-baseline. If readings still disagree by more than 5%, flip the controller into safe mode. The safe-mode thresholds it will use are these.

config for yahap-bajof:
[istix]
host = istix.qorvelsys.internal
user = istix_svc
database = istix_prod

Subject: Term sheet from Quillbrook Ventures

Team — and welcome aboard, Sorcha — Quillbrook has sent a revised term sheet for the Larkspire platform partnership. Headline terms: three-year exclusivity in the Merrow corridor, tiered revenue share starting at 12%, and a co-marketing commitment. Legal flags the exclusivity scope as too broad. We respond by Friday. Our negotiating position is set out in the confidential note below.

board note of fahif-yahog: Gross margin on Wenath came in at 10 percent against a plan of 5 percent. Only 3 of the 100 pilot accounts renewed Wenath, so a churn review is set for July 15.